Bookhammers Pond
Bookhammers Pond is a lake in Sussex County, Delaware. Bookhammers Pond is situated nearby to the locality Donovan Development, as well as near the hamlet Murrays Corner.Places of Interest

United States lightship Overfalls
Photo: Acroterion,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Lightship Overfalls was the last lightvessel constructed for the United States Lighthouse Service before the Service became part of the United States Coast Guard. She is currently preserved in Lewes, Delaware as a museum ship. United States lightship Overfalls is situated 2 miles north of Bookhammers Pond.
Lewes Presbyterian Church
Church
Photo: Doug Kerr,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Lewes Presbyterian Church is a historic Presbyterian church building located at 100 Kings Highway in Lewes, Sussex County, Delaware. It was built in 1832, as a frame meeting house measuring 45 feet by 37 feet.

Carpenters Corner
Locality
Carpenters Corner, Delaware is a village two miles south of Lewes and four miles northwest of Rehoboth Beach in Sussex County, at. The village is located on Delaware Route 1, and is named for two prosperous dairy farmers.
